Description

Idyllic countryside, great views, no near neighbours. You have sole use of a field with access to woods and footpaths to the river Wye.

The setting

Wild camping - peaceful, idyllic location no near neighbours - groups welcome.

The spots

Rough pasture - flat ground

The sanitary facilities

Cold tap with drinking quality water.

A phone charging area with WC, bath/shower, sink are in the farmhouse but have separate entrance and are for your use only.

There is a tap with drinking water.

The activities

Campfire, music, nature walks, wild swimming or kayak in the river.

Other things

Dogs welcome and there is space for them to run or play frisbee!


Rules

We welcome groups minimum price £100.
